City.Hall, Monday October 27, 1952 - 5 P.P.i.
The Council met in adjourned session - Mayor Timothy I.O'Reilly presiding.
Present: D.M.Carpenter, Paul W.Davis, Fred Lucksinger, Timothy I. O'Reilly
Absent: Frank V.Woods
Firs order of business:
This being the time set as per advertised Notice forreceiving Bids on FOOTHILL
WATERLINE IiP., the following bids were received and publicly opened and read:
1 - W.M. Lyles Co., P.O,Box 889, S.L.G. Amt. 11,0$6.30
2 - ';Jestern States Engineers, Inc. Los Angeles, 12726.50
3 - L.E. Webb Constr. Co. Santa Maria, Calif. 92490.60
After studv and review it was moved by D.M.Carpenter, seconded by Fred Lucksinger, the
bid be awarded to L.E. Webb Construction Co. of Santa Maria in the amount of $192490.60
and the following Resolution be adopted:
Resolution No. 1153 (New Series) - A Resolution accepting Bid for Foothill
Water Line was passed and adopted on motion of D.M.Carpenter, seconded by Fred Lucksinger
upon the following roll call vote:
Ayes: D. M. Carpenter, Paul W. Davis, Fred Lucksinger, Timothy I.G'Reilly
Noes: None
Absent: Frank V.Woods
The Public Works Dept. was authorized to hire 1','illie Mac Baker, Sr. Engineering
Aid on a six months probationery period at $268.00 per month as of Oct. 31, 1952.
The Council granted approval for installation of Utilities for providing heat
and lights to the new lookout tower on Terrace Hill for "Operation Skywatchrr.
On motion of D.M.Carpenter, seconded by Fred Lucksinger, the City Engineer was
authorized to purchase approximately $1500 worth of water pipe from the L.B.Nelson Co.
pipe to be used on west Foothill hater line extension.
